The anatomy of a blind spot

Every regulatory failure begins with an assumption that nothing will go wrong today. In the dry language of the official probe, experts spent hours dissecting the failure of active and passive fire protection systems. They talked about fire doors that failed to close automatically, missing compartmentation, and outdated warning systems that stayed silent when they should have screamed.

But consider what happens on the ground long before a match is struck.

Let us look at a hypothetical resident named Wah. He runs a small dry-goods business on the lower levels of a decades-old composite building, while sleeping in a partitioned space upstairs. To Wah, a fire door is not a critical life-safety barrier meant to withstand one thousand degrees of heat for two hours. To him, it is a heavy piece of wood that blocks the breeze on a hot July morning. So, he wedges a wooden block under it.

He needs air. He gets convenience.

But when a fire breaks out three floors below, that single wooden block transforms the stairwell from an escape route into a chimney. The smoke, thick with toxic carbon monoxide, rushes upward at several meters per second. The trap snaps shut.

The expert panel pointed out that more than sixty percent of old buildings inspected in the district showed similar minor, daily infractions. A blocked corridor here. An uninspected extinguisher there. None of these actions are malicious. They are born from the friction of modern life scraping against old infrastructure. We trade tiny increments of safety for tiny increments of comfort, completely unaware that we are compiling a debt that the universe eventually collects.

The arithmetic of survival

During the hearings, structural engineers put forward a series of sweeping reforms. They want mandatory upgrades for buildings constructed before the mid-1990s. They want wider enforcement zones. They want smart sensors that communicate directly with the fire services department the moment ambient temperatures spike.

The math behind these proposals is clear. Upgrading a single older high-rise with modern fire shutters and integrated sprinkler systems costs significant capital. To a building management committee made up of retired pensioners, that number looks like an impossible mountain.

Here is the real problem. The cost of prevention is always visible, categorized in neat columns on a spreadsheet. The cost of a catastrophe is completely invisible until the day it happens.

How do you value the peace of mind of an old woman living on the twelfth floor who knows her building can protect her for the forty-five minutes it takes for a ladder truck to extend to her window? How do you quantify the weight of a firefighter’s gear as he climbs a dark, smoke-logged stairwell, knowing the building's wet risers might not have any water pressure when he reaches the top?

The panel’s report made it clear that relying on voluntary compliance is a failed strategy. The human brain is simply not wired to fear a statistical probability. We see a clear sky and assume it will never rain. The experts are arguing that the state must step in to force our hand, transforming safety from an individual choice into a non-negotiable public utility.

Where the smoke settles

But the proposed reforms face a wall of practical friction. If the government mandates that every old building must install secondary escape routes or advanced fire-retardant barriers, where does the space come from?

Tai Po is a tapestry of history, where wet markets sit beneath high-rises and narrow alleys serve as logistics hubs for hundreds of families. You cannot simply rewrite the geometry of these streets with the stroke of a pen.

If you tighten the rules on subdivided flats—the absolute epicenter of vulnerability in these incidents—you run headfirst into a housing crisis. Tenants live there because they have nowhere else to go. If an inspector shuts down an unsafe unit because its escape window is blocked by a makeshift kitchen, the tenant does not magically find a safer apartment. They often find themselves on the street.

Safety is expensive. Poverty is more expensive.

This is the knot the investigators are trying to untangle. True reform cannot just be a list of penalties and prohibitions. It must be an economic blueprint. The experts suggested creating a centralized subsidy fund, a mechanism where the city absorbs the financial shock of upgrading these old structures so the burden does not fall entirely on the vulnerable.
